Freddie Goodwin (born 18 June 1996) is an Australian filmmaker, director, and screenwriter. He is the chief executive officer (CEO) of Mob Productions and the creator of the Mob Cinematic Universe, a shared fictional franchise spanning multiple feature films.

Goodwin is a three-time recipient of the Best Director Award, having won in 2021, 2025, and 2026. His consecutive wins in 2025 and 2026 made him the fourth director to receive the award in back-to-back years, while his three total wins place him among the most awarded directors in the category’s history.

He won his first Best Director Award in 2021 for Echoes in the Static. In 2025, he received the award for The Foldpoint Paradox, followed by a third win in 2026 for The Flash: Speed of Time.
